Cross-border electronic commerce's Significance to Economy

Question 1: What are the benefits of cross-border e-commerce? Cross-border electronic commerce refers to an international business activity in which transaction subjects belonging to different customs reach a deal, make payment and settlement through e-commerce platform, and deliver goods and complete the transaction through cross-border logistics. Cross-border electronic commerce has promoted the economic development, and at the same time started the transformation of world trade, which has brought benefits to many enterprises and consumers.

First of all, cross-border electronic commerce provides new opportunities for enterprises to build international brands.

In the Internet era, brand and word-of-mouth are important components of enterprise competitiveness, and are also key factors to win the favor of consumers. At present, the quality and performance of products and services of many domestic enterprises are very good, but they are not known to overseas consumers. Cross-border electronic commerce can effectively break the channel monopoly, reduce intermediate links, save transaction costs and shorten transaction time, which provides an effective way for China enterprises to create brands and enhance brand awareness, especially for some "small but beautiful" small and medium-sized enterprises, thus creating more "invisible champions" with international competitiveness. At present, 80% of foreign trade enterprises in China have begun to use e-commerce to explore overseas markets.

Second, cross-border electronic commerce is a new impetus to promote the upgrading of industrial structure.

The development of cross-border electronic commerce has directly promoted the development of modern service industries such as logistics distribution, electronic payment, electronic authentication, information content service and related electronic information manufacturing industry. At present, there are more than 5,000 e-commerce platform enterprises in China, and a number of well-known e-commerce platform enterprises, logistics express delivery and third-party payment local enterprises have accelerated their rise. More prominently, cross-border electronic commerce will lead to changes in the mode of production and industrial organization. Facing the diversified, multi-level and personalized overseas consumption demand, enterprises must take consumers as the center, strengthen cooperation and innovation, build a perfect service system, strengthen R&D design and brand sales while improving product manufacturing technology and quality, reconstruct value chain and industrial chain, and maximize the optimal allocation of resources.

Third, cross-border electronic commerce has provided a new starting point for * * to improve the level of opening up.

The development of cross-border electronic commerce involves commerce, customs, inspection and quarantine, finance, taxation, quality supervision, finance and other departments, as well as international cooperation in many fields. This not only puts forward new requirements for * * * *' s rapid response ability, innovation ability and cooperation ability, but also puts forward new challenges to * * * *' s traditional institutional mechanism. Taking cross-border electronic commerce as the starting point, promoting the resource sharing, efficient operation, unified cooperation and innovative services of * * * departments will play a powerful role in promoting the level of China's opening up.

For enterprises, cross-border electronic commerce has greatly broadened the path to enter the international market, greatly promoted the optimal allocation of multilateral resources and mutual benefit and win-win among enterprises; Also promoted the related development; It has played a certain role in the opening-up level of * *. Detailed explanation of two cross-border electronic commerce models

Let's analyze the advantages and disadvantages of various cross-border import e-commerce models:

M2C mode: From the manufacturer to the consumer, the platform is responsible for attracting investment.

Typical player: Tmall International

The advantage is that users have high trust, because these businesses need overseas retail qualifications and authorization, and goods can be directly mailed from overseas, which can provide local return and exchange services; The pain point is that most of them are operated by third parties, so the price is high, the brand control is weak, and the model is constantly improving.

Two B2C modes: bonded self-operation+direct mining

Typical players: JD.COM, Jumei and Honey Bud.

The advantage is that the platform directly participates in the transaction process of supply organization, logistics and warehousing, with high sales turnover and good timeliness. Usually, B2C players will attach modes such as "direct mail+flash purchase" to supplement SKU richness and ease the pressure on the supply chain.

The pain point lies in the limited categories. At present, this model is mainly based on explosives and standard products. In some areas, the commodity inspection customs are independent, and the goods that can enter the country are restricted according to different local policies. For example, health care products and cosmetics cannot enter Guangzhou. At the same time, there is also financial pressure, because whether it is to fix the upstream supply chain, improve the timeliness of logistics customs clearance, build warehouses in the bonded area, or do marketing, subsidize users, and improve conversion repurchase, a lot of funds are needed. The gross profit margin of explosives and standard products is extremely low, but it still needs to maintain steady development. Capital injection is particularly important at this moment. At this stage, bosses with funds, flow and resource negotiation ability have stepped in. This model basically establishes the threshold and is not suitable for startups to enter the market easily.

Here, let's talk about the vertical category of mother and baby in the fire separately. First-team players have honey buds or something. The advantage of the maternal and child category is that it is the easiest to win the cross-border incremental market and only needs high frequency and large flow, which is the starting point for most family units to contact Haitao goods. Most maternal and child e-commerce companies hope to shorten the supply chain, build brands and gain trust flow on single products. In the future, they will gradually expand to other high-profit or spot categories and dilute the concept of imported goods.

The pain point lies in the particularity of maternal and child categories. At present, domestic users only recognize a few explosive brands, and mothers also know how to look at the place of origin, and they don't buy them if they are not from the place of origin. The explosive products of Kao and other brands cannot be directly contracted for supply in China. The current situation of maternal and child e-commerce is to use the composite supply chain to ensure the supply of goods, such as foreign distributors, wholesalers, foreign supermarkets, e-commerce sweepers, buyers and domestic importers. As a result, the upstream supply chain is unstable, the price is basically transparent and there is no gross profit. Some players even broke their arms to promote the battle. At present, almost all powerful e-commerce giants regard the maternal and child category as a necessary category to attract conversion traffic, while startup companies gradually reduce the maternal and child ratio or find another way to start differentiated competition in different directions.

Three C2C modes: overseas buyer system

Typical players: Taobao Global Purchase, Taobao Tianxia, Ocean Terminal Sweeping Artifact, Sea Honey, Street Honey.

Overseas buyers (individual purchasing agents) set up shop on the platform, and in terms of categories, long-tail non-standard products are the main products. At present, global purchase has merged with ceramics. Although it seems to be the largest cross-border C2C import, there are also many inherent problems, such as the difficulty in distinguishing the authenticity of goods and the contradiction between the original merchants and overseas buyers. There is still a long way to go to gain the trust of consumers.

In terms of advantages, C2C mode is the mode I like and expect at present, which constructs the width of supply chain and the choice of products. Question 8: Why do successful logistics operations play a vital role in cross-border e-commerce? 1) The international logistics service level is the guarantee for the development of cross-border e-commerce. The operation of cross-border electronic commerce involves information flow, business flow, capital flow and logistics. During the operation of cross-border electronic commerce, information flow, business flow and capital flow can all be realized in the virtual environment through computers and network communication equipment, but the logistics link cannot be realized in the virtual environment; The international logistics system includes seven subsystems: warehousing, transportation, distribution, distribution processing, packaging, handling and information processing. Efficient, high-quality and low-cost international logistics system operation is the guarantee to promote the development of cross-border electronic commerce.

(2) The improvement of cross-border electronic commerce's efficiency and benefit puts forward higher requirements for international logistics services. With the development of cross-border electronic commerce, higher requirements are put forward for international logistics services. International logistics enterprises need to constantly update information technology and logistics technology, enhance the responsiveness of international supply chain, reduce the cost of international logistics, and improve the level of intelligent management and customer service, thus promoting the promotion of cross-border electronic commerce.
